随笔分类 - Python
摘要:1.安装setuptools登录http://pypi.python.org/pypi/setuptools#files下载setuptools-0.6c11.win32-py2.6.exe(md5) 打开setup.py执行即可。 2.其实在安装pydelicious之前要安装feedparser软件包,本来以为很简单,就下载了feedparser和pydelicious软件包,分别运行两个文件里面的setup.py,都出现了以下的错误: >>>Traceback (most recent call last): File "C:\Documents and Se
阅读全文
摘要:函数的定义def,这个关键字通知python:我在定义一个函数冒号和缩进来表示的隶属关系return可以返回多个值,以逗号分隔。相当于返回一个tuple(定值表)。在Python中,当程序执行到return的时候,程序将停止执行函数内余下的语句。return并不是必须的,当没有return, 或者return后面没有返回值时,函数将自动返回None。None是Python中的一个特别的数据类型,用来表示什么都没有,相当于C中的NULL。None多用于关键字参数传递的默认值。函数调用和参数传递Python有丰富的参数传递方式,还有关键字传递、表传递、字典传递等,基础教程将只涉及位置传递a = 1
阅读全文
摘要:1、运算数学 +, -, *, /, **, % >>>print 3**2 # 乘方 判断 ==, !=, >, >=, >>print 4>5, 4>=0 # >, 大于; >=, 大于等于 >>>print 5 in [1,3,5] # 5是list [1,3,5]的一个元素逻辑 and, or, not2、缩进和选择if语句之后的冒号:以四个空格的缩进来表示隶属关系, Python中不能随意缩进if : statementelif : statementelif : statementelse: sta
阅读全文
摘要:变量不需要声明,数据类型是Python自动决定的。不需要删除原有变量就可以直接赋值,回收适用。以L结尾,表示长整型在数字面前加0,表示八进制;加0x表示十六进制;给浮点数前加0,没有变化布尔类型要注意大小写,True或Falseprint的另一个用法,也就是print后跟多个输出,以逗号分隔。内置函数type(), 用以查询变量的类型。序列有两种:tuple(定值表; 也有翻译为元组) 和 list (表)>>>s1 = (2, 1.3, 'love', 5.6, 9, 12, False) # s1是一个tuple >>>s2 = [Tru
阅读全文

浙公网安备 33010602011771号